diff --git a/caravel/__init__.py b/caravel/__init__.py index 26c2a4561473..19064f14391c 100644 --- a/caravel/__init__.py +++ b/caravel/__init__.py @@ -22,6 +22,11 @@ app = Flask(__name__) app.config.from_object(CONFIG_MODULE) +if not app.debug: + # In production mode, add log handler to sys.stderr. + app.logger.addHandler(logging.StreamHandler()) + app.logger.setLevel(logging.INFO) + db = SQLA(app) cache = Cache(app, config=app.config.get('CACHE_CONFIG'))